你查询的IP:[121.4.128.60]  地理位置:中国–上海–上海

最新查询219.82.92.60 122.49.18.68 61.232.130.8 122.8.71.247 118.242.194.101 203.86.83.80 121.32.92.47 124.20.77.180 123.178.90.45 121.4.128.60 202.131.208.237 202.130.88.246 202.14.235.13 114.80.55.128 121.224.228.51 203.119.32.60 222.168.126.119 116.4.137.236 121.46.35.93 119.4.185.35 203.88.32.84 210.78.223.86 123.177.2.200 203.212.80.190 210.26.65.51 210.52.129.57 118.102.16.103 123.101.236.116 210.15.128.166 192.124.154.191 202.131.16.16